NoPendingCount: Fix for message requests

This commit is contained in:
Nuckyz 2024-06-01 23:39:58 -03:00 committed by Vendicated
parent ed5ae2ba5c
commit 23584393a9
No known key found for this signature in database
GPG key ID: D66986BAF75ECF18

View file

@ -62,6 +62,16 @@ export default definePlugin({
replace: "return 0;"
}
},
// New message requests hook
{
find: "useNewMessageRequestsCount:",
predicate: () => settings.store.hideMessageRequestsCount,
replacement: {
match: /getNonChannelAckId\(\i\.\i\.MESSAGE_REQUESTS\).+?return /,
replace: "$&0;"
}
},
// Old message requests hook
{
find: "getMessageRequestsCount(){",
predicate: () => settings.store.hideMessageRequestsCount,